Pool Patio Sealing in Gig Harbor, WA
Pool patio sealing services involve applying a protective coating to the surface around a swimming pool to enhance durability and appearance. This process is suitable for various types of pool decks, including concrete, stone, and pavers, helping to prevent water penetration, staining, and surface deterioration caused by weather exposure and regular use. Property owners often seek this service to maintain the longevity of their pool area, improve its visual appeal, and reduce maintenance needs over time.
Before requesting pool patio sealing, homeowners typically want to understand the condition of their existing surface, including any cracks or damage that may need repair beforehand. It’s also important to consider the type of surface material, as different sealing products are designed for specific materials. Clarifying the desired finish, such as matte or gloss, and understanding the recommended maintenance routine after sealing can help ensure the best results and long-lasting protection for the pool area.

Pool Patio Sealing Questions
What is pool patio sealing? Pool patio sealing involves applying a protective coating to surfaces around the pool to prevent damage from water, UV rays, and weathering.
Why should property owners consider sealing their pool patio? Sealing helps extend the lifespan of the patio, reduces slip hazards, and maintains its appearance over time.
What types of surfaces can be sealed around a pool? Common surfaces include concrete, pavers, natural stone, and stamped concrete.
How often should pool patio sealing be maintained? Regular inspections and resealing are recommended every few years to ensure optimal protection and appearance.
